Maribyrnong Community Centre

Maribyrnong Community Centre is a council-managed centre where members of our community can come together to participate in lifelong learning opportunities, participate in health and wellbeing programs, enjoy social activities and develop new friendships.

The Centre is home to many local community groups which meet on a regular basis to run their programs and hold regular meetings.
